summ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John N. Laliberte <allanonjl@gentoo.org>2005-07-03 20:36:36 +0000
committerJohn N. Laliberte <allanonjl@gentoo.org>2005-07-03 20:36:36 +0000
commit5a0af33c59c9c7bdab43e3f45adb41b3d01cc8f4 (patch)
tree6f2694e142e85621fe29e972679a74c46c955026 /dev-util/meld
parentsecurity fix for bug #96991, all ebuilds have patch applied. (diff)
downloadhistorical-5a0af33c59c9c7bdab43e3f45adb41b3d01cc8f4.tar.gz
historical-5a0af33c59c9c7bdab43e3f45adb41b3d01cc8f4.tar.bz2
historical-5a0af33c59c9c7bdab43e3f45adb41b3d01cc8f4.zip
version bump to fix #85325. Now depends on gnome-python-extras so it has support for line numbering and source highlighting.
Package-Manager: portage-2.0.51.19
Diffstat (limited to 'dev-util/meld')
-rw-r--r--dev-util/meld/ChangeLog9
-rw-r--r--dev-util/meld/Manifest6
-rw-r--r--dev-util/meld/files/digest-meld-0.9.51
-rw-r--r--dev-util/meld/meld-0.9.5.ebuild86
-rw-r--r--dev-util/meld/metadata.xml3
5 files changed, 102 insertions, 3 deletions
diff --git a/dev-util/meld/ChangeLog b/dev-util/meld/ChangeLog
index df162e2c6d0f..832042610ee6 100644
--- a/dev-util/meld/ChangeLog
+++ b/dev-util/meld/ChangeLog
@@ -1,6 +1,13 @@
# ChangeLog for dev-util/meld
# Copyright 2000-2005 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/dev-util/meld/ChangeLog,v 1.21 2005/05/29 21:48:03 allanonjl Exp $
+# $Header: /var/cvsroot/gentoo-x86/dev-util/meld/ChangeLog,v 1.22 2005/07/03 20:36:36 allanonjl Exp $
+
+*meld-0.9.5 (02 Jul 2005)
+
+ 02 Jul 2005; John N. Laliberte <allanonjl@gentoo.org> metadata.xml,
+ +meld-0.9.5.ebuild:
+ version bump to fix #85325. Now depends on gnome-python-extras so it has
+ support for line numbering and source highlighting.
*meld-0.9.4.1-r1 (29 May 2005)
diff --git a/dev-util/meld/Manifest b/dev-util/meld/Manifest
index 2189efe1cd3b..304e16e7b702 100644
--- a/dev-util/meld/Manifest
+++ b/dev-util/meld/Manifest
@@ -1,8 +1,10 @@
MD5 96ed5fd3c9961f4e4787f897e666bddb meld-0.9.2.ebuild 1538
MD5 46b08e3752195ea4162e574e4fa5dff8 meld-0.9.4.1.ebuild 1785
-MD5 bc187df3c729c50cd1b03deeda6c551a ChangeLog 3139
-MD5 03ad2e6c4ab41244af1015a8bbb0b39f metadata.xml 158
+MD5 1675df734c0ee0b201b90151b5edd4f4 ChangeLog 3388
+MD5 f4713bbf77ae895c7ff6c022a7a2f542 metadata.xml 222
MD5 eeabce0c4942083a42738302deb53c3c meld-0.9.4.1-r1.ebuild 2071
+MD5 d84b937a4b699901bd79b64c52a7a4c5 meld-0.9.5.ebuild 1996
MD5 a594b965f0dc8995e79d245c4cb37fd3 files/digest-meld-0.9.4.1-r1 65
MD5 a594b965f0dc8995e79d245c4cb37fd3 files/digest-meld-0.9.4.1 65
MD5 204fd0bd70dc55fec4d8b060a3165d94 files/digest-meld-0.9.2 63
+MD5 f5c312891794c9078a4c034256c3901c files/digest-meld-0.9.5 63
diff --git a/dev-util/meld/files/digest-meld-0.9.5 b/dev-util/meld/files/digest-meld-0.9.5
new file mode 100644
index 000000000000..1dda9b12bb0e
--- /dev/null
+++ b/dev-util/meld/files/digest-meld-0.9.5
@@ -0,0 +1 @@
+MD5 dc86bf6f5ed1887da6a28ac1d91eb78d meld-0.9.5.tar.bz2 283080
diff --git a/dev-util/meld/meld-0.9.5.ebuild b/dev-util/meld/meld-0.9.5.ebuild
new file mode 100644
index 000000000000..389817eb3cff
--- /dev/null
+++ b/dev-util/meld/meld-0.9.5.ebuild
@@ -0,0 +1,86 @@
+# Copyright 1999-2005 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+# $Header: /var/cvsroot/gentoo-x86/dev-util/meld/meld-0.9.5.ebuild,v 1.1 2005/07/03 20:36:36 allanonjl Exp $
+
+inherit python gnome.org eutils
+
+DESCRIPTION="A graphical (GNOME 2) diff and merge tool"
+HOMEPAGE="http://meld.sourceforge.net/"
+
+LICENSE="GPL-2"
+SLOT="0"
+KEYWORDS="~x86 ~alpha ~sparc ~ppc ~amd64"
+IUSE=""
+
+DEPEND=">=dev-lang/python-2.2
+ >=gnome-base/libglade-2
+ >=gnome-base/libgnome-2
+ >=dev-python/gnome-python-1.99.15
+ >=dev-python/pygtk-1.99.15
+ >=dev-python/pyorbit-1.99.0
+ dev-python/gnome-python-extras
+ "
+
+MAKEOPTS="${MAKEOPTS} -j1"
+
+pkg_setup() {
+
+ if ! built_with_use pygtk gnome ; then
+ einfo ""
+ einfo "Meld requires pygtk be built with the gnome use flag set."
+ einfo "Please re-emerge pygtk with the gnome use flag set."
+ einfo ""
+ die "You need to re-emerge pygtk with gnome use flag."
+ fi
+}
+
+src_unpack() {
+
+ unpack ${A}
+ # Fix the .desktop icon name, see bug #73550
+ sed -i -e "s:Icon=meld:Icon=meld-icon.png:" ${S}/meld.desktop.in
+
+}
+
+src_compile() {
+ emake || die "make failed"
+}
+
+src_install() {
+ # do manual injection of *dirs instead of using make install
+ # to get around lack of DESTDIR
+ cd ${S}
+ python tools/install_paths libdir=/usr/lib/meld < meld > meld.install
+ newbin meld.install meld
+
+ insinto /usr/lib/meld
+ doins *.py
+ python tools/install_paths \
+ localedir=/usr/share/locale \
+ docdir=/usr/share/doc/${P} \
+ sharedir=/usr/share/meld < paths.py > paths.py.install
+
+ newins paths.py.install paths.py
+
+ insinto /usr/share/meld/glade2
+ doins glade2/*
+ insinto /usr/share/meld/glade2/pixmaps
+ doins glade2/pixmaps/*
+ insinto /usr/share/pixmaps
+ newins glade2/pixmaps/icon.png meld-icon.png
+
+ insinto /usr/share/applications
+ doins meld.desktop
+
+ dodoc AUTHORS COPYING INSTALL TODO.txt
+ insinto /usr/share/doc/${P}
+ doins manual/*
+}
+
+pkg_postinst() {
+ python_mod_optimize /usr/lib/meld
+}
+
+pkg_postrm() {
+ python_mod_cleanup /usr/lib/meld
+}
diff --git a/dev-util/meld/metadata.xml b/dev-util/meld/metadata.xml
index da6fd63d0085..6ffa481fda37 100644
--- a/dev-util/meld/metadata.xml
+++ b/dev-util/meld/metadata.xml
@@ -2,4 +2,7 @@
<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d">
<pkgmetadata>
<herd>gnome</herd>
+<maintainer>
+ <email>allanonjl@gentoo.org</email>
+</maintainer>
</pkgmetadata>